Multiplex Assay Market size was valued at USD 4.05 Billion in 2024 and is poised to grow from USD 4.43 Billion in 2025 to USD 9.17 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 9.5% during the forecast period (2026-2033).
The global multiplex assay market is experiencing significant growth driven by the increasing prevalence of chronic and infectious diseases, the advantages of multiplex assays over traditional methods, and their expanding role in companion diagnostics. The approval of new companion diagnostics is expected to further enhance market potential, particularly in identifying patients who would benefit from targeted therapies. Early diagnosis of diseases like cancer is crucial, as it can significantly improve survival rates and patient quality of life, leading to heightened awareness in the healthcare sector. Moreover, the rising demand for automated systems and high-throughput assays, along with the validation of biomarkers, amplifies opportunities for market expansion. Furthermore, multiplex assays facilitate extensive biomarker analysis, streamlining the development of innovative diagnostics in various disease areas.

Driver of the Multiplex Assay Market
The increasing interest in personalized medicine is significantly propelling the multiplex assay market. These advanced assays facilitate the concurrent assessment of multiple biomarkers, which enhances the ability to classify patients based on their individual responses and biological characteristics. Consequently, this capability leads to more tailored treatment strategies, improving patient outcomes and optimizing therapeutic efficacy. As healthcare continues to evolve towards more individualized approaches, the role of multiplex assays becomes increasingly vital in delivering precision medicine solutions, ultimately transforming patient care and boosting the overall market for these innovative diagnostic tools.
Restraints in the Multiplex Assay Market
One key market restraint for the global multiplex assay market is the complexity and high cost associated with assay development and implementation. The intricate nature of multiplex assays, which require sophisticated technologies and specialized equipment, can deter smaller laboratories or facilities from adopting these advanced testing methods. Additionally, the need for extensive training and technical expertise to operate multiplex assay systems further complicates the market landscape. These factors can limit accessibility and increase operational expenses, ultimately hindering adoption rates among potential users and slowing market growth. Furthermore, regulatory hurdles related to validation and approval processes can introduce additional challenges.
Market Trends of the Multiplex Assay Market
The multiplex assay market is witnessing a notable trend driven by the growing adoption of multiplex immunoassays, which enable the simultaneous measurement of multiple proteins from a single sample. This capability significantly enhances efficiency in drug discovery, diagnostic testing, and biomarker identification processes, catering to the rising need for rapid and comprehensive analysis in healthcare and research. Additionally, advancements in assay technologies and the integration of automation are further propelling market growth. As researchers and clinicians increasingly seek cost-effective, high-throughput solutions, the demand for multiplex assays is expected to expand, solidifying their role as essential tools in modern analytical practices.
